I would return!Written 31 December 2018This review is the subjective opinion of a Tripadvisor member and not of TripAdvisor LLC. - Indah EdlightzOntario, Canada2,519 contributionsSeattle -Tacoma (SEA) is a nice and easy to navigate airport south of downtown Seattle . its not very busy and Its fairly close to downtown..... $35 uber ride. its quite spacious and now it has tables and chairs spaced out so you can sit down and do some work if you'd like, which has not been the case in many airports. Its has some good restaurants and bar and places for coffee.. typical places for snacks and quick touristy gadgets. my biggest pet peeve is that the car rental places are a bus ride away... more and more airports are doing this but its not ideal, as you have to budget for extra time to wait for shuttles. Otherwise its a decent airport.Written 10 April 2022This review is the subjective opinion of a Tripadvisor member and not of TripAdvisor LLC.
